Story Archive
2003-01-07
International War Crimes Tribunals are courts of law established to try those accused of committing atrocities and crimes against humanity during war time. These include genocide, torture and rape.
2003-01-07
International War Crimes Tribunals are courts of law established to try those accused of committing atrocities and crimes against humanity during war time. These include genocide, torture and rape.